14:02 — On-call paged for memory pressure on the sheetforge workers. 14:09 — Confirmed the spreadsheet export path was materializing entire workbooks in memory instead of streaming rows; a 900k-row export consumed roughly 6 GB per request. 14:21 — Drained the export queue and capped concurrent exports at two per worker. 14:40 — Hotfix deployed enabling the streaming writer by default; memory returned to baseline within eight minutes. The remediated build can be identified by the trace token recorded below.

session token of bawep-yadup = htk21_528abd376e3c5a4ec24a1

# Break-Glass: Bounce Processor (Mailwrack)

Use only when the bounce queue exceeds 50k and normal admin auth is down. Break-glass grants 30-minute root on the Mailwrack worker pool. Every action is recorded; file an incident within the hour. Steps: open the Torchkey console, select the bounce-processor scope, confirm with a second on-call. The console will prompt for the break-glass passphrase, which is:

vault phrase of hahop-badug = novvan-ulaion-zorius-noviel-gorwyn-casix-tamys

## Bounce Processor: classification overhaul

This PR reworks the Wrenmail bounce processor so support no longer sees soft bounces misfiled as permanent failures. Hard bounces now suppress the address immediately; soft bounces enter a retry window and only suppress after repeated failures. The ticket queue should shrink noticeably, since transient mailbox-full events stop generating alerts. Suppression reasons now appear in the customer record. The thresholds governing this behavior are listed below.

tuning constants:
QUOTAS = {
    "druwyn": 5,
    "holix": 5,
    "zorath": 5,
    "holwyn": 10,
}